Go rewatch some of those. They aren't as good as you remember. The problem is with dunking the first time you see a specific kind of move it's the wow factor because of the novelty. Then you see a hundred more people do the same move, and doing a lot of them in games, and they lose their shine. So now the dunkers have to always keep coming up with novel and new ways to dunk, and thanks to the limitations of the human body there are only so many ways to do that. So then they turn to gimmickery to make it feel fresh and new. The Superman dunk was technically not even a dunk. He didn't touch the rim. Raising the backboard, using 2 backboards, jumping over things, pretty much everything you can think to jump over has already been done. Multiple people have jumped over cars already. So the contest lost it's edge, the best players didn't want to get injured or it became de rigeur which rapidly lead to blase. So now you get no-name and new players dunking instead which is definitely less fun to watch. That particular activity was simply destined to become boring. There is only so far it can go.
